If anyone could ever be described as the ideal teacher, that person would have to be Jesus Christ. Looking to Him as an ideal type of teacher, what can we learn?
Christ the Word, Christ the Logos, exemplifies three key characteristics for teachers to learn from today. First, teaching must always be logocentric: There is some truth (or, in the case of Christ Himself, the Truth) that is being taught. Teaching assumes, believes, demands that truth is real, that it can be known, and that it can be communicated. Teaching like Christ, then, begins with a logos, a truth that is to be taught.
From there, He demonstrates two ways to teach that truth: Mimetic and Socratic.
